Rolex 116610 real vs fake dial issue

Hello everybody, i have a question concernig submariner authenticity.
Im a happy owner of a 116610LN pre 2015 with a frosted clasp. Both mine, rolex website examples and the majority of genuine watches i have seen (LVs and LNs) have a proper spacing on the dial between 300 and m
looks like 300 m
all the fakes even the very best ones with cloned movements ive noticed that have it spelled more like 300m with much less spacing between
Now on chrono24 i have seen some dated 2013 and 2018 as full sets that appear ok with every other aspect but they have that narrow 300m spacing.
My question is where there any genuine dials like that or is it a dead giveaway of the watch being fake despite being a full set etc
